This book makes a fundamental contribution to the study of urbanism in the Roman provinces with a detailed and copiously illustrated archaeological account of the first decade of one of the best-excavated cities in the Roman Empire. It draws on both published and archived archaeological evidence, to which it applies a novel methodology.
